Bmw E36 Main Bearing Cap Bolts. Bmw has been building the. I'm wondering whats so special about the m10x75 10.9 grade bmw main bearing cap bolts, used in almost all older bmw engines. This part is listed by bmw as bmw part number 11111735525 (11 11 1 735 525) and is described as a m10x75mm hex bolt used to fasten the main. 45 rows you should replace your main cap bolts any time you tear down an engine for rebuilds to ensure proper torque is applied. That fastener is not a tty fastener, thus can be reused basically indefinitely. I have 12000 racing miles on an m20 rebuilt engine with main bearing cap bolts being reused multiple times. To determine which bearings your engine was built with, bmw told you by engraving the block and crank with the bearing color codes.
